Output 29f6af90dc826c2d32f5fac5889980bd82cfe6a676d403f7bf2689b4c1237fd8:1

value
62011
script pubkey
OP_0 OP_PUSHBYTES_20 bf29ef583f0a90bc8f90a115ac977633848023f5
address
bc1qhu577kplp2gterus5y26e9mkxwzgqgl4v9t52w
transaction
29f6af90dc826c2d32f5fac5889980bd82cfe6a676d403f7bf2689b4c1237fd8
confirmations
2926
spent
true